What Trends can you wear for Spring 2010?
Well the answer to that question depends on your age and your body type. It can sometimes be frustrating to flip through fashion magazines and see all the great new clothes, only to realize that you are not size a 2 or 6 feet tall.
First and foremost you DO NOT have to wear the latest fashion trends to be fashionable. You can simply integrate a few into your existing wardrobe and ignore the rest. Identifying the trends that work with your body and your lifestyle is the key.
Here are few Spring 2010 Fashion Trends you may want to integrate into your wardrobe:
The Boyfriend Blazer
This trend from Fall 2009 is still going strong. This blazer style is very versatile and works on many body types. Wear it for day, or for evening, at work or on the weekends.
- Wear with skinny jeans or leggings, boyfriend jeans, short skirt and even over a dress.
- If you are not comfortable wearing skinny jeans or leggings (or if you are over 40 and could not wear them well if you wanted to) try pairing the boyfriend blazer with slacks or ankle cropped pants. This pairing could tend to be too masculine, so make sure you add a good amount of accessories and a terrific pair of shoes.
- Even paired with leggings, this blazer can be appear masculine so make sure you pair it with feminine top, add great accessories and don’t forget the heels!
- Boyfriend blazers should be slightly roomy but you shouldn’t look like you are swimming in it. Maybe go up one size, but no more.
- One of the things that makes this look work is rolling up of the sleeves of the blazer. This is must! Look for linings that when rolled up, add interest to your outfit.
- Choose a blazer that is fitted and will create an hourglass shape. Avoid blazers that look to boxy.
- If the blazer come with shoulder pads, please, please take them out! Otherwise you will look like a throwback to the eighties. (The boyfriend blazer actually is throwback to the eighties itself but without the shoulder pads and its updated styling it can safely reside in the new millennium!)
Prints, Prints and More Prints
The one word that defines prints for Spring is BOLD. Say goodbye to subtle prints and colors and welcome eye catching florals, tribal, ikat and tie dye. Dresses, skirts, tops and even pants are being expressed in these graphic prints.
- When choosing tops in these new prints, make sure the pattern and color does not overwhelm you. Hold the garment up to your face (or better yet put it on), take a look in the mirror and determine if you see your face or the pattern first. If it is your face, then buy the beautiful piece. If it is the pattern or color of the garment, then move on and try another one.
- Printed pants can be tricky to wear. If the pants are relaxed, pair with a more fitted top. If the pants are more for fitting, go for a more flowy top.
- Patterned pants will draw attention to your bottom half. If you are larger on the bottom, you will want to stay away from skinny, fitted versions and op for relaxed ones instead.
- A high-waisted style of the printed pant can be very sophisticated looking. Pair with a great pair of heels and a more understated top.
Short Full Skirts
If you are over 40, you may want to just ignore this trend. Short skirts are for the young, even if you have the legs for them. Dressing your age is something I feel very strongly about. When was the last time you found a short skirt in any department but juniors?
- Called the “dress alternative” for Spring
- The choices are vast: pleated, belted, ruffled, patterned.
- Dress up for evening out or down for casual, weekend wear
- Wear with a simple fitted shirt, a feminine blouse and even a jacket
- Accessorize simply and wear either strappy heels or a gorgeous flat
- Can be worn with tights
